Canine with a double coat won't have straight hair, however the undercoat might be gentle. The fur also tends to be longer and denser. In case your dog has a single coat, it can usually be straight and smooth. Do Double-Coated Canines Shed? Sure, most canine with double coats are shed twice yearly. That is usually in the fall and the spring. Throughout this time, they just shed their undercoat.

Many breeds are labeled as herding dogs—sheepdogs, cattle canines, shepherds, or collies. Herding canine come in all styles and sizes from all over the world. They're adept at herding in mountainous areas, flat fields, and all-weather situations. Herding canines have slightly different flock administration types, such because the border collie, which stays at the entrance of the herd, curbing wanderers through the use of its stare to maintain the herd together in a gaggle. Heelers like Australian cattle canine or corgis are driving canine that keep pushing the animals forward. Typically, they stay behind the herd.


The bearded collie doesn’t look much just like the more common tough collie, however they’re nonetheless great cattle canine which have developed their heavy coats to adapt to the unpredictable but often miserable weather of the Scottish highlands. The bearded collie compares in look usually compared to a sentient mop, and they have energetic and irreverent personalities that they’ll maintain throughout their 11 to 15-12 months lifespan.
